sys.dm_resource_governor_configuration(Transact-SQL)
적용 대상:SQL Server
Azure SQL Managed Instance
현재 유효한 리소스 관리자 구성이 포함된 행을 반환합니다.
열 이름 | 데이터 형식 | 설명 |
---|---|---|
classifier_function_id |
int |
sys.objects현재 사용되는 분류자 함수의 개체 ID입니다. 사용 중인 분류자 함수가 없으면 0을 반환합니다. nullable이 아닙니다. 참고: 이 함수는 새 요청을 분류하는 데 사용되며 규칙을 사용하여 이러한 요청을 적절한 워크로드 그룹으로 라우팅합니다. 자세한 내용은 Resource Governor참조하세요. |
is_reconfiguration_pending |
bit | 리소스 관리자 구성이 변경되었지만 ALTER RESOURCE GOVERNOR RECONFIGURE 사용하여 현재 유효한 구성에 적용되지 않았는지 여부를 나타냅니다. 리소스 관리자 재구성이 필요한 변경 내용은 다음과 같습니다.- 리소스 풀을 만들거나 수정하거나 삭제합니다. - 워크로드 그룹을 만들거나 수정하거나 삭제합니다. - 분류자 함수를 지정하거나 제거합니다. - 볼륨당 미해결 I/O 작업의 최대 수에 대한 제한을 설정하거나 제거합니다. 반환되는 값은 다음 중 하나입니다. 0 - 재구성이 필요하지 않습니다. 1 - 보류 중인 구성 변경 내용을 적용하려면 재구성 또는 서버 다시 시작이 필요합니다. 참고: 리소스 관리자를 사용하지 않도록 설정하면 반환되는 값은 항상 0입니다. nullable이 아닙니다. |
max_outstanding_io_per_volume |
int |
적용 대상: SQL Server 2014(12.x) 이상 볼륨당 미해결 I/O 작업의 최대 수입니다. |
설명
이 동적 관리 뷰는 현재 유효한 구성을 보여줍니다. 저장된 구성 메타데이터를 보려면 sys.resource_governor_configuration사용합니다.
예제
다음 예제에서는 저장된 메타데이터 값과 리소스 관리자 구성의 현재 유효 값을 가져와 비교하는 방법을 보여 줍니다.
USE master;
-- Get the stored metadata
SELECT OBJECT_SCHEMA_NAME(classifier_function_id) AS classifier_function_schema_name,
OBJECT_NAME(classifier_function_id) AS classifier_function_name
FROM sys.resource_governor_configuration;
-- Get the currently effective configuration
SELECT OBJECT_SCHEMA_NAME(classifier_function_id) AS classifier_function_schema_name,
OBJECT_NAME(classifier_function_id) AS classifier_function_name
FROM sys.dm_resource_governor_configuration;
사용 권한
VIEW SERVER STATE
권한이 필요합니다.
SQL Server 2022 이상에 대한 사용 권한
서버에 대한 VIEW SERVER PERFORMANCE STATE
권한이 필요합니다.